Transaction 53578aaccc16b839f5a9aaad3cdc45478045f83d68eb9497001a98aa1953cd6c
1 Input
1 Output
-
53578aaccc16b839f5a9aaad3cdc45478045f83d68eb9497001a98aa1953cd6c:0
- value
- 2387136
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bc70c5543c42e5036ee7dca01cc386edcbc493c
- address
- bc1q90rsc42rcsh9qdhw0h9qrnpcdmwtcjfun7rmk6